We stayed at the airport Hyatt for our last cruise (NYE 2007/2008), and we were really glad we did. As long as you have your luggage outside your door by 10 pm (iirc, may have been 11) with the special DCL tags on them, the next time you see your bags are in your stateroom. The cruise we were on was booked solid, so it was no surprise to see a large amount of bags waiting in the hall that evening. The next morning there was quite a line to get checked in, and then there was a wait for the busses... it takes a couple of hours between the check-in and actually getting on the bus (they call people down to the busses in groups of about 50 as the busses come in).
You may be able to check in at the DME counter downstairs, but there was a special check-in specifically for those of us staying at the Hyatt. Not sure what the line would have been like downstairs or when they would have started taking guests to the terminal.

I stayed at the Hyatt before my cruise last December.
When you check in, they will give you a sheet that tells you when to check in at the Hyatt lobby for your DCL transfers (NOT Magical Express).
You tag your luggage with the DCL tags and leave them inside your room. Just take your carryon with you.
My meeting time was at 9am.

We just returned from my 4th cruise, and third stay at the Hyatt MCO prior to cruising.
Each time it has been somewhat different, but this time, we needed to have our luggage ready to go and just inside the door of our room by 8 or 830 (can't really remember), and then you could check in from 9-1030. If you want on the first bus (which it seems doesn't matter to you either way), you should be down way before 9. We were there at 9 and got on the second bus with a ship boarding card of 6 (still able to make Palo ressies and get a fantastic seat at Topsiders!).
When they start taking people down, you go down in bus groups (Mickey, Donald, Pooh groups for example). This year it was to the motor coach entrance of the hotel, last year they walked us down to the DME area. I don't know how its determined where they put you on, but in my solo trip to WDW in April, they had a DCL group in the DME area.
They don't just do luggage transfers, so if you don't go on the bus, your luggage will not either (much like DME). If you don't want your luggage to be transfered, then you can have them put under the bus, and they can check it in at the port as well.
They have a sign the day before to notify the front desk if you are going to sail on DCL. They give you a paper with all the info you need and have you down as a guest of DCL. Easy as that!
